Webb12 apr. 2024 · 12 April 2024. Being inside IR35 means your contract falls in the off-payroll working rules and HMRC sees you as an employee for tax purposes. Being outside IR35 means your contract points towards self-employment, so you can operate tax efficiently. Webb16 apr. 2024 · IR35 or Intermediaries Legislation is a UK tax law. It is about tax and National Insurance Contributions (NIC) for those providing services to a client through a Personal Service Company (PSC) or ...
